Easter Nests
These Easter nests are a great way of using up any leftover chocolate and Easter eggs. Essentially it's just a basic chocolate crispies recipe, but with some mini eggs sprinkled on top. They really are so quick and easy to make, and so are simply perfect for little children who love to help out in the kitchen!
Preparation Time 15 minutes - Chilling Time 1 hour - Makes 8-10 Easter nests
Ingredients 225g chocolate, broken into small pieces 50g rice crispies 50g butter 2 tablespoons of golden syrup Mini eggs to decorate
Method 1. Melt the chocolate, butter and golden syrup in a bowl over a pan of gently simmering water. 2. Once melted, carefully remove the bowl from the pan and stir in the rice crispies. 3. Divide the mixture equally between some paper cases and press a few mini eggs into the tops of each. Chill for an hour.
Variations You could also use cornflakes instead of rice crispies, or stir in a handful of raisins to the chocolate crispies mixture.
